Gift certificates have come a long way since the first physical store gift certificates were introduced in the 1990s. At first, gift certificates were primarily plastic or paper vouchers that could only be redeemed at a single retailer. Major retailers like Walmart, Target, and Starbucks were among the first companies to issue gift certificates as a gift-giving alternative to cash. Over the next decade, gift certificates usage grew steadily as more merchants adopted the concept.

The real growth spurt happened in the 2000s with the rise of digital and multi-store gift certificates. Companies like GiftCards.com launched websites where users could purchase digital gift certificates that could be delivered instantly by email. This helped address some of the main pain points with physical cards like loss, damage, and expiration dates. Multi-store cards like Visa and American Express gift certificates also hit the market, allowing recipients to spend their values at thousands of participating merchants.

A feller buncher is a forestry harvesting machine used to cut down trees and gather them into piles. It works mechanically or hydraulically and is mounted on tracks or wheels, allowing it to operate in rugged forest terrain. Feller bunchers are equipped with tree grapples to grab and place tree trunks into piles after felling. This makes tree processing more efficient compared to manual labor. The global forestry sector is expanding due to rising demand for timber and wood products. As conventional logging methods require excessive manpower, feller bunchers have emerged as a productive alternative for large-scale commercial harvesting. Their ability to fell trees cleanly and quickly while minimizing damage to remaining trees and the surrounding vegetation has increased their adoption worldwide.

Digital product passport software allows manufacturers, suppliers, and retailers to record critical information about a product, its components, materials and supply chain journey on a digital platform. Such software helps verify product authenticity and trace its origins throughout its lifecycle. With growing concerns around product safety, sustainability and counterfeiting, governments across various regions are introducing mandates that require manufacturers to implement digital product passports for specific products and materials. For instance, the European Union’s Waste Framework Directive mandates product passports for electronics and batteries by 2024 and 2026 respectively. Similarly, in China the Extended Producer Responsibility policy requires manufacturers to adopt digital tools to manage recyclability information of their products. The thermal camera market is a niche technology domain that has found widespread applications across various industrial sectors such as construction, commercial, automotive and maritime in recent years. Thermal cameras offer advanced vision capabilities that detect infrared radiations emitted by objects and convert them into visual images. This helps users analyze heat patterns that are invisible to the naked eye. With growing infrastructure development activities and increasing focus on predictive maintenance in industries, demand for thermal imaging solutions for inspection, surveillance and monitoring purposes has surged globally.

Thermal cameras are used for a variety of non-destructive testing and machine vision applications in various industries. In the construction sector, they help inspect building envelopes for moisture intrusion, check insulation performance and locate air leaks. Additionally, thermal imaging solutions find broad usage in commercial establishments like hotels, shopping malls and cafes to monitor energy efficiency of HVAC systems and boost asset uptime.

Synthetic sapphire, commonly known as manufactured sapphire, is an artificially produced sapphire which is crystalline corundum, an aluminum oxide with trace amounts of other metal oxides such as iron, titanium, chromium and magnesium. It has properties like hardness, transparency and durability which make it valuable for industrial applications such as wear parts, window materials and electronic displays. Synthetic sapphire is widely used as a scratch resistant protective cover in smartphones, smartwatches and other consumer electronic devices. Its high transmittance of visible light and infrared radiation also enables its usage in applications like LED lights, medical devices and camera lenses. Rising adoption of sapphire substrates in semiconductor fabrication due to superior properties has propelled the demand for synthetic sapphire globally in recent years.
